Description
Delicious bite-sized treats made with crushed Oreos, butter, and chocolate.
Ingredients
- 30 (340g) regular or gluten-free Oreo cookies
- 3 tablespoons (45g) unsalted butter, melted and cooled
- 2-5 tablespoons whole milk
- 8 ounces (225g) dark, semi-sweet, or white chocolate, chopped
- 1 teaspoon vegetable oil (optional)
Instructions
- Line a medium-sized baking sheet or cutting board with parchment paper and set aside.
- Add the Oreos (with the filling) to a large food processor and grind until they become fine and crumbly.
- Add melted butter and 2 tablespoons of milk to the Oreo crumbs and pulse until well moistened. Add more milk if needed.
- Scoop out tablespoon-sized portions and roll into smooth balls, arranging them on the parchment-lined baking sheet.
- Chill the balls in the freezer for 5-10 minutes until firm enough to roll smoothly.
- Place the Oreo balls in the freezer for at least 15 minutes before dipping in chocolate.
- Melt the chocolate in a microwave-safe bowl or over a double boiler.
- Drop an Oreo ball into the melted chocolate, toss to coat, and lift with a fork to allow excess chocolate to drip off.
- Place the chocolate-dipped Oreo ball back onto the parchment sheet and add optional toppings if desired.
- Chill the Oreo balls in the fridge or freezer until the chocolate sets before serving.
